NEW WHEELS!!! (get your mind out of the gutter)

I know I said we were going to get the rim's power coated pink but I couldn't help myself, I had to lace them up!

They came out good too. Brian cut the spokes for me when we stopped by Trail Head Saturday, and nailed the lengths.

The Specs.

Pink Chris King 28 hole classic road hubs
Blue USA Ti Spokes,
Front: 297mm 3x (nailed it)
Rear: 295mm 3x Drive (could have used 294mm) 297mm 3x Non-Drive (good)
Blue (and a couple of black) USA Al Nipples (14mm)
Black Mavic 28 hole OpenPro
Velox Rim Tape
Specialized Houffalize CX 700X32 S-Works Tire
